Change the plate at the bottom of the gearstick. (Try adjusting it first)

Golf Loon
17-04-2007, 08:27 AM
Or grind a bit off the bottom of the plate under the car, so that you can move it over further.

Make sure all the bushings are ok, as if there is play in em, you`ll never manage it.

I adjust em by setting the box in 5th with the 13mm nut loose. Get someone to hold the stick in the optimum position for 5th and then do up the nut. All should then be achieveable.
